What are account assignment models?

Account assignment templates in SAP Business One, in short, are templates that serve to both simplify and standardise the posting of similar business transactions. In particular, they contain information on relevant G/L or business partner accounts, tax codes and the distribution of transaction amounts as percentage values. This enables consistent and efficient accounting. The use of these templates ensures that recurring postings are not only recorded correctly in accordance with tax regulations, but also with the company's internal guidelines, which ultimately contributes to financial integrity and compliance.

Creation of account assignment templates in SAP Business One

The creation of an account assignment template in SAP Business One begins in the module finance where you open the window for account assignment templates and switch to entry mode. After entering a code and a description for the template, you define the relevant accounts with the percentages and tax codes.

For hospitality expenses, for example, a G/L account with 70% is created for tax-deductible operating expenses. In addition, a further account with 30% has been created for the non-deductible portion. The input tax is recognised uniformly with the indicator V2 for 19%, as the deduction restriction does not affect the input tax. The account assignment template deliberately leaves out the contra account open in order to ensure flexibility in the reimbursement of expenses.

Account assignment templates in SAP Business One

An account assignment template is used when creating a journal entry in the Financial Accounting module. After selecting the account assignment template, the posting lines are automatically filled in with the predefined accounts, percentages and tax codes. This actually simplifies the entry of complex postings considerably and minimises sources of error.

Flexibility for deviating business transactions

An account assignment template in SAP Business One not only offers efficiency and Standardisation . It also provides the necessary flexibility to be able to react to deviating business transactions. By resetting the template, users can adjust the percentage distribution and thus fulfil individual posting requirements.

The implementation of account assignment templates can save a considerable amount of time in your accounting routine. This is especially true for frequently recurring accounting transactions, where the use of such templates is particularly effective. A striking application example of this is the management of the cash book.

By creating specific account assignment templates with memorable names for each type of transaction in the cashbook - be it deposits or withdrawals - the posting process can be simplified considerably. In typical small to medium sized businesses, it is common for cashbook transactions to be repetitive, so a selection of around 30 to 40 different templates is sufficient to cover the majority of these postings.

For the remaining transactions that fall outside this repetitive pattern, it is advisable to carry out classic journal entries. The time savings realised in this way when processing cash book transactions can therefore be considerable.

account assignment models

Account Assignment Model is a reference method used in document entry when the same distribution of amounts to several Company Codes, cost centers, accounts, etc., is frequently used. Instead of manually distributing the amount among accounts or Company Codes, you may use equivalence numbers for distributing both the credit and debit amounts. A cross-Company Code account assignment model can also be created.

The account assignment model may contain any number of GL accounts. The GL account items  need not be complete. The model can be used across several Company Codes, and can even include Company Codes from non-SAP systems.

Remember, The use of account assignment models is limited to GL accounts.

Valuation and Account Assignment

The valuation in SAP can be at the plant level or the company code level. If you define valuation at the plant level then you can have different prices for the same material in the various plants. If you keep it at the company code level you can have only price across all plants.

Valuation also involves the Price Control .Each material is assigned to a material type in Materials Management and every material is valuated either in Moving Average Price or Standard Price in SAP. These are the two types of price control available.

What is Account assignment in SAP FICO ?

Updated Apr 01, 2023

Account assignment is a critical aspect of financial accounting and management in any organization. It refers to the process of allocating financial transactions to specific cost or profit centers, projects, or business processes. By properly assigning financial transactions to the appropriate account, organizations can accurately track their expenses, revenues, and profitability. This information can then be used to make informed decisions about resource allocation, cost control, and overall financial management. 

In SAP FICO, account assignment is a core module that offers various types of account assignment options, including cost center accounting, profit-center accounting, internal order accounting, and WBS element accounting. These options provide organizations with greater visibility into their financial performance, enabling them to optimize their operations and drive greater value for their stakeholders.

Types of  Account Assignment 

There are several types of account assignments in SAP FICO, including:

  • Cost center accounting 
  • Profit center accounting
  • Internal order accounting
  • WBS element accounting

i) Cost center accounting 

Cost center accounting is the process of tracking and analyzing costs associated with each department, function, or unit of an organization. SAP FICO provides a module that allows organizations to create and manage cost centers, allocate expenses, and generate reports to track performance.

By tracking expenses at a granular level, organizations can make informed decisions about resource allocation, identify areas of inefficiency, and make changes to improve overall performance, reducing costs and increasing efficiency.

ii) Profit center accounting

Profit center accounting is a process that allows organizations to track revenues and expenses at a granular level, providing insights into the profitability of individual business units, product lines, or geographic regions. By allocating revenues and expenses to specific profit centers, organizations can generate reports that help identify areas of high profitability or inefficiency.

SAP FICO provides a comprehensive profit center accounting module that enables organizations to create and manage profit centers, allocate revenues and expenses, and generate reports to analyze profitability. This information can be used to make informed decisions about product lines, investments, and resource allocation, enabling organizations to optimize their profitability and drive growth.

iii) Internal order accounting 

Internal order accounting is a process that allows organizations to track and control expenses associated with a specific project, event, or business process. By assigning costs to a specific internal order, organizations can monitor actual expenses versus budgeted expenses, and ensure that resources are allocated efficiently.

iv) WBS element accounting

WBS (Work Breakdown Structure) element accounting is a process that allows organizations to track and control expenses associated with a specific project or work breakdown structure. It involves breaking down large projects into smaller, manageable tasks or work packages, each of which is assigned a WBS element.

Expenses are then allocated to each WBS element to track actual versus planned expenses and ensure that resources are allocated efficiently.

Introduction of a new manual journal entry transaction – FV50

Duke Finance is excited to announce a new SAP transaction for creating manual journal entries. The new transaction, FV50 – Park GL Account Document, offers improved transaction mechanics, increasing the ease and efficiency of processing journal entries. FV50 will replace SAP transaction F-65 – Park Document.

Additionally, account assignment templates will replace account assignment models used by many in the Duke community to assist with manual journal entries. Like models, account assignment templates provide processing efficiencies for those users who create routine manual journal entries.

The designated transition window for users to move to FV50 will run between May and August 2023. During this window, Duke Finance is offering overview sessions focusing on the following:

  • Specific details on the FV50 transaction, including a demonstration.
  • Guidance on journal entry functionality that is not changing, including using ZF104 for JV uploads, transaction ZF418 for managing cost transfers for federally sponsored projects, workflow routing and approval, and other reports helpful to managing journal entries.
  • Details on the online resources and training material that will be available to assist with the transition.

As of September 1, 2023, Duke will remove the current manual journal entry transaction – F-65 – Park Document – SAP journal entry transaction and all users will be required to utilize transaction FV50 for processing of manual journal entries.
